Coty Inc. reported earnings per share of -$0.03 for its first fiscal quarter of 2026, falling sharply short of the consensus estimate of -$0.0025. The negative surprise of -1100% underscores a significant bottom-line miss. Revenue figures were not disclosed in this release, and the stock declined by 4.48% following the announcement.

Coty’s Q1 2026 performance was marked by a notable earnings miss, with an actual EPS of -$0.03 versus expectations of near break-even. The large surprise may reflect higher-than-anticipated input costs, unfavorable product mix, or elevated promotional spending in the beauty sector. While specific revenue data were not provided, the company’s operational results appear to have been pressured by persistent inflation in raw materials and logistics, as well as a cautious consumer environment in certain markets. On the positive side, Coty has continued to invest in its prestige fragrance and cosmetics portfolio, which historically supports higher margins. However, the earnings shortfall suggests that cost controls and demand recovery may not have materialized as quickly as management had hoped. Investors will be watching for more granular segment breakdowns in future filings to assess whether the miss was concentrated in mass-market or luxury categories.
